NAMM 2024: All updates in Music Technology

The latest and greatest in music technology have started unfolding as the National Association of Music Merchants (NAMM) once again descended on Southern California. Transforming the Anaheim Convention Center into an energetic hub of innovation, NAMM 2024 highlighted breakthrough new products alongside reveals from legacy brands evolving for the future. Korg went berserk with a series of new products. Pioneer DJ along with parent company, AlphaTheta also generated substantial buzz by showcasing new products under the name AlphaTheta. Established European influences also migrated stateside, as German design giant Neumann displayed its state-of-the-art MT 48 immersive audio interface. Catering extensively to software and virtual instruments as well, exhibiting brands underscored the growing reach of music technology. Through new hardware, forward-thinking software, and innovations utilizing machine learning, this year’s NAMM expo spotlights the ever-expanding versatility and precision of music technology design across the board.
